From orchard to ocean.

Stage 01
Raw Procurement
Raw cashew nuts sourced from Kollam-region farms. Each batch assigned a traceable lot code (EC-KLM-YYYY-LOT-XXX) before processing begins.
Origin traceability
Stage 02
Steam Shelling
Low-temperature steam softens the shell without scorching the kernel. Preserves natural colour, fat integrity, and flavour — critical for W180/W240 premium grades.
Low-temp · colour-safe
Stage 03
Manual Peeling
Testa (inner skin) removed by skilled workers — 95% female. Manual peeling delivers lower testa-contamination rates than mechanical alternatives.
Testa ≤ 1% target
Stage 04
Size Grading
Kernels graded by count-per-pound into W180, W240, W320 and downgrade fractions (splits, butts, pieces). Each grade packed separately under its own lot.
Count-per-pound grading
Stage 05
QA Inspection
Moisture content, breakage percentage, defect rate, and testa count sampled per CODEX Alimentarius CXS 040-1981 cashew kernel standard before packing is authorised.
CODEX standard
Stage 06

Final stage
Nitrogen-Flushed Vacuum Sealing

Approved lots packed into 25 kg vacuum-sealed tins (whole grades) or 50 kg bulk kraft bags (pieces, Borma). All tins are nitrogen-flushed before sealing to eliminate oxygen and extend shelf life to 24+ months. Final weight check, labelling, and lot-code stamp applied before palletisation.

25 kg vacuum tins N₂-flushed 24+ month shelf life

// QA Parameters
Quality Specifications

What we measure — every batch.

Moisture
≤ 5%
Max by weight · whole grades
Breakage
≤ 2%
W180 / W240 / W320 target
Testa
≤ 1%
Inner skin contamination
Defects
≤ 3%
Discolour / gummy / insect
Fat Content
~45%
Dry basis · roasted variants higher
Shelf Life
24 mo
Vacuum + N₂ sealed · cool storage
// Signature Process
Drum Roasting

The Kollam drum-roast technique.

Eastern Cashew's drum-roasted range is a Gulf favourite — used in premium retail packs under the Royal Nuts brand and in bulk for food service buyers in Kuwait, Qatar, and the UAE.

Drum roasting uses a rotating cylindrical drum over a controlled heat source — kernels tumble continuously for even colour and bite without scorching. The result: a consistent golden-amber roast with lower moisture (≤ 3%) and intensified natural flavour.
